import json
import os
import re
import socket
import struct
from subprocess import check_output
from time import sleep
HDHR_NAME = 'HDHR'
DEVICE_DISCOVERY_PORT = 65001
FWD_UDP_PORT = 65002
wifi_ip = None
hdhr_ip = None
while (not wifi_ip) or (not hdhr_ip):
wifi_ip = check_output(["hostname", "-I"]).decode("utf-8").split(" ")[0]
if wifi_ip:
print(f'found WiFi IP: {wifi_ip}')
else:
print('did not find WiFi IP')
sleep(0.5)
continue
raw_network_scan = [
re.findall('^[\w\?\.]+|(?<=\s)\([\d\.]+\)|(?<=at\s)[\w\:]+', i) for i in os.popen('arp -a')
]
network_scan = [dict(zip(['NAME', 'LAN_IP', 'MAC_ADDRESS'], i)) for i in raw_network_scan]
network_scan = [{**i, **{'LAN_IP':i['LAN_IP'][1:-1]}} for i in network_scan]
print(f'network_scan: {json.dumps(network_scan, indent=4, sort_keys=True)}') # pretty print
for network_peer in network_scan:
if network_peer['NAME'] == HDHR_NAME:
hdhr_ip = network_peer['LAN_IP']
print(f'found {HDHR_NAME} IP: {hdhr_ip}')
break
if not hdhr_ip:
print('could not find HDHR')
sleep(0.5)
MCAST_GRP = '224.1.1.1' # multi-cast group (don't modify)
MCAST_PORT = DEVICE_DISCOVERY_PORT
IS_ALL_GROUPS = True
sock = socket.socket(socket.AF_INET, socket.SOCK_DGRAM, socket.IPPROTO_UDP)
sock.setsockopt(socket.SOL_SOCKET, socket.SO_REUSEADDR, 1)
if IS_ALL_GROUPS:
# on this port, receives ALL multicast groups
sock.bind(('', MCAST_PORT))
else:
# on this port, listen ONLY to MCAST_GRP
sock.bind((MCAST_GRP, MCAST_PORT))
mreq = struct.pack("4sl", socket.inet_aton(MCAST_GRP), socket.INADDR_ANY)
sock.setsockopt(socket.IPPROTO_IP, socket.IP_ADD_MEMBERSHIP, mreq)
while True:
data, requestor = sock.recvfrom(1024)
print(f'got query from {requestor}')
print('forwarding to HDHR')
with socket.socket(socket.AF_INET, socket.SOCK_DGRAM, socket.IPPROTO_UDP) as hdhr_sock:
hdhr_sock.bind((wifi_ip, FWD_UDP_PORT))
hdhr_sock.sendto(data, (hdhr_ip, DEVICE_DISCOVERY_PORT))
hdhr_reply_data, (hdhr_addr, hdhr_port) = hdhr_sock.recvfrom(1024)
print(f'HDHR reply from {hdhr_addr}:{hdhr_port}')
print('forwarding HDHR reply to original requestor')
sock.sendto(hdhr_reply_data, requestor)
